About three weeks ago, OCMS posted a Facebook video of huge chandeliers being hoisted into place in what will be the tasting room at Revelton Distillery. July 2nd, OCMS staff were treated to a tour of facilities by Co-owner, Rob Taylor and saw the nine-foot crystal and brass fixtures installed. During the walk around, Rob explained how the tasting room could be divided for events, and where customers could view the distilling level below. The original small kitchen has been expanded and reconfigured for a caterer’s kitchen. “We can’t wait to see the finished product of the new Revelton Distillery.  It is going to be a great tourist attraction for Osceola and draw so many people to town,” said Eckels.

Although Rob could not, yet, commit to an opening date, he says progress is good. Watch this space for more updates.


Pictured Right: The penthouse was craned in July 2nd to prepare for the arrival of the 32 foot tall vendome continuous flow column still.
